Free Trolley in Alexandria
If you’re visiting historic
Alexandria, Virginia, watch for the
colourful new King Street Trolley,
which runs along King Street from
the Potomac River waterfront to the
King Street Metro station from 10
a.m. to 10 p.m. daily. With frequent
stops for hopping on and off to
check out the shops, restaurants
and attractions found along
Alexandria’s lovely main street, it’s
an easy (and free) way to explore
the Old Town. For information,
check www.visitalexandriava.com or
call 1 800 388-9119.
Gluten-Free Travel
If you’re trying to avoid gluten
in your diet, perhaps because of a
celiac disease diagnosis, you know it
can be challenging to travel comfortably.
Hilary Davidson, a travel
writer who’s written for a wide variety
of Canadian magazines, is trying
to make this easier for you: she’s
started a Gluten-Free Guidebook
blog, available free at
www.GlutenFreeGuidebook.com,
where she posts reviews of restaurants,
B&Bs, shops and other places
that she’s found while travelling in
South America, Europe and North
America.
